Power Steering An Essential Component for Modern Vehicles


Power steering has transformed the way we drive, making the act of maneuvering vehicles not just easier but also safer. This critical system may be taken for granted by many drivers, but its significance cannot be overstated. The essence of power steering lies in its ability to amplify the driver's steering input, thereby enhancing control and comfort during driving.


Historically, steering systems in vehicles were entirely mechanical, largely relying on human strength to turn the steering wheel. This often proved to be a cumbersome task, especially in larger vehicles or when parking. With advancements in technology, power steering was introduced, significantly changing the driving experience.

One of the most significant benefits of power steering is the enhanced safety it provides. Power steering allows for smoother and more precise steering control, which is essential in emergency situations where quick and accurate vehicle response is crucial. In situations requiring rapid adjustments, such as evasive maneuvers or sudden turns, power steering considerably improves a driver's ability to maintain control, thereby reducing the risk of accidents.


Furthermore, power steering systems have evolved with the integration of technology, allowing for features such as variable ratio steering. This technology adjusts the steering response based on the vehicle's speed, offering more agility during low-speed maneuvers while maintaining stability at higher speeds. Such advancements not only enhance the driving experience but also empower the driver with a greater sense of confidence and control behind the wheel.


However, like any mechanical system, power steering is not without its issues. Drivers may occasionally experience a loss of power assist, often indicated by a heavy steering wheel. This could stem from a failure in the hydraulic pump, electrical issues in EPS systems, or low fluid levels in hydraulic systems. Regular maintenance and timely checks can help mitigate these problems and ensure that the power steering system operates smoothly.
